Job Description
Summary :
We are seeking a highly skilled IR Tech for a 13-week travel contract . This position supports both inpatient and outpatient cases (50 / 50 split), and covers a wide range of interventional radiology procedures. Candidates must have IR-specific experience and be able to float across Swedish campuses. EPIC and Pyxis experience are highly preferred. This is an auto-offer role , but the candidate must pass Aya clinical screening before submission.
Responsibilities :
Assist with a wide range of complex interventional procedures, including :
Y-90 chemo delivery, uterine ablations, chemoembolizations, GI bleeds
Biopsies, drains, central lines, port-a-cath access, vein sampling
Administer and monitor TPA, blood / blood products , and support procedural sedation
Handle triple lumen catheters, vascular device access , and Phase 2 recovery care
Maintain sterile field, scrub and circulate procedures, and set up interventional equipment
Work in both inpatient and outpatient settings in a fast-paced IR department
Utilize EPIC for documentation and Pyxis for medication management
Be available for call duty once weekly and one weekend every 5–6 weeks
Travel between Swedish campuses if needed
